Annotation
The oscillation spectrum of a self-excited oscillator with a "hard" limit cycle under nonresonant parametric or power input of a harmonic signal is calculated theoretically with certain simplifying assumptions. The variation of the spectrum in response to variation of the input frequency outside of multiple-locking bands is considered. It is shown that the locking mode is established in re sponse to multiple inputs only by drawing of the oscillator's frequency, without damping of the self-oscillations. An experiment performed in the radio-frequency band with input multiplicities n = 2 and n = 4 shows good qualitative agreement with the theoretical conclusions.
